Moojan Momen wrote the book, Islam and the Baha’i Faith, in an effort to introduce the Baha’i Faith to Muslims. In 1844, the Baha’i Faith began in Persia, and the followers of the Babi and Baha’i Faiths have been persecuted by authorities in countries where Islam is the faith practiced by the majority. […]
